안녕하세요.
이제 막 델파이를 시작한 초보입니다.
소스를 보다 보면 아래와 같은 걸 많이 보는데,
그 의미를 잘 몰라서 글 올립니다.
--------------------------------------------------------------
function ScriptOnExportCheck(Sender: TIFPSPascalCompiler; Proc: TIFPSInternalProcedure; const ProcDecl: string): Boolean;
begin
....
end;
---------------------------------------------------------------
여기서 Sender는 TIFPSPascalCompiler형, Proc는 TIFPSInternalProcedure형, ProcDecl는 string형이고 리턴값은 Boolean형이라는 것까지는 알겠습니다만
각각이 이 함수에서 어떤 의미를 가지고 있는지 모르겠네요.
Sender는 어떤 의미인지?, Proc 는 이 함수에서 어떤 역활을 하는지 등...
아시는 분의 답변 부탁드립니다.
그럼 좋은 하루 보내세요.
TIFPSPascalCompiler 형의 인수죠..ㅡㅡ;
다른걸 예로 들면..
procedure TForm1.FormCreate(Sender: TObject);
begin
(Sender as TForm).Caption := '이게 Sender입니다.';
end;
procedure TForm1.Button1Click(Sender: TObject);
begin
TButton(Sender).Caption := '나는 버튼입니다.';
end;
이런식으로 사용하죠...
그런데..님이 예로 들어주신 함수에 대해서는 할말이...ㅡㅡ;
즐코